Varna

Varna is a coastal city on the Black Sea. It's the third largest city in Bulgaria and many people consider it the summer capital of the country. It's a major tourist destination and it can make for a relaxing escape at the beach if you're in Bulgaria during the summer. It is the only city in Bulgaria that cruises visit, and as such, it's tourist infrastructure has grown. In addition to being a tourist destination, Varna is also a business and university center, seaport, and the headquarters of the Bulgarian Navy and merchant marine.

Ghent

Ghent is a large city in the northern part of Belgium (the Flanders region) with a population of about 250,000. This city was one of the most powerful cities in Europe during the Middle Ages, which is portrayed today, mostly through architecture. There is a large university in Ghent with over 60,000 students, and a large portion of the population are young students. However, among the natives and students, there are also many foreigners and artists that you will find walking the streets of the city. Ghent is also Belgium's second largest port city.

Which place is cheaper, Ghent or Varna?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Varna is $65, while the average daily cost in Ghent is $127.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Varna and Ghent in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Varna or Ghent?

Both destinations experience a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. And since both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Varna or Ghent in the Summer?

The summer attracts plenty of travelers to both Varna and Ghent. Furthermore, many travelers come to Ghent for the family-friendly experiences.

In the summer, Varna is a little warmer than Ghent. Typically, the summer temperatures in Varna in July average around 23°C (73°F), and Ghent averages at about 17°C (63°F).

People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Ghent this time of the year. In Varna, it's very sunny this time of the year. Varna usually receives more sunshine than Ghent during summer. Varna gets 268 hours of sunny skies, while Ghent receives 202 hours of full sun in the summer.

In July, Varna usually receives less rain than Ghent. Varna gets 37 mm (1.5 in) of rain, while Ghent receives 66 mm (2.6 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Should I visit Varna or Ghent in the Autumn?

The autumn brings many poeple to Varna as well as Ghent. Additionally, many visitors come to Ghent in the autumn for the shopping scene and the natural beauty of the area.

In October, Varna is generally a little warmer than Ghent. Daily temperatures in Varna average around 14°C (57°F), and Ghent fluctuates around 12°C (54°F).

In the autumn, Varna often gets more sunshine than Ghent. Varna gets 161 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Ghent receives 105 hours of full sun.

Varna usually gets less rain in October than Ghent. Varna gets 36 mm (1.4 in) of rain, while Ghent receives 78 mm (3.1 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Varna or Ghent in the Winter?

Both Ghent and Varna are popular destinations to visit in the winter with plenty of activities. Also, most visitors come to Ghent for the museums, the shopping scene, and the cuisine during these months.

Ghent can be very cold during winter. Varna can get quite cold in the winter. Varna is around the same temperature as Ghent in the winter. The daily temperature in Varna averages around 3°C (37°F) in January, and Ghent fluctuates around 3°C (38°F).

Varna usually receives more sunshine than Ghent during winter. Varna gets 83 hours of sunny skies, while Ghent receives 47 hours of full sun in the winter.

In January, Varna usually receives less rain than Ghent. Varna gets 38 mm (1.5 in) of rain, while Ghent receives 59 mm (2.3 in) of rain each month for the winter.

Should I visit Varna or Ghent in the Spring?

Both Ghent and Varna during the spring are popular places to visit. Also, the spring months attract visitors to Ghent because of the natural beauty.

In the spring, Varna is a little warmer than Ghent. Typically, the spring temperatures in Varna in April average around 11°C (52°F), and Ghent averages at about 8°C (47°F).

In the spring, Varna often gets around the same amount of sunshine as Ghent. Varna gets 156 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Ghent receives 158 hours of full sun.

Varna usually gets around the same amount of rain in April as Ghent. Varna gets 44 mm (1.7 in) of rain, while Ghent receives 45 mm (1.8 in) of rain this time of the year.
